## TallySweep Reconciliation Job

TallySweep reconciles warehouse counts against the Cartonet ledger nightly at 02:15. If counts diverge by more than the drift threshold, the job halts and pages ops. Do not rerun mid-cycle; partial runs corrupt the delta table. Safe restart: clear the lock row, then trigger manually. Logs rotate daily; keep seven days. Check the Brundle shard first — it historically lags. Runtime settings the job reads at startup are as follows.

settings of tahof-yahap:
quenwyn:
  log_level: error
  metrics_host: metrics.quenwyn.lumiclabs.internal
  pool_size: 8

### Runbook: Report export timezone mismatches (Glimmerfield)

If a customer reports that exported totals differ from the dashboard, check whether their report schedule predates the March cutover — older schedules still render in server-local time rather than the account timezone. Re-saving the schedule fixes it. Before escalating, confirm the export worker is running with the expected timezone settings shown below.

config for kadup-kajog:
[raldor]
host = raldor.tolvaqworks.internal
user = raldor_svc
database = raldor_prod

Onboarding: Scanbridge barcode integration

For the release manager. Scanbridge links our warehouse handhelds to the Tallyard inventory service. Scanner firmware and the decode service must ship together; a version skew causes mis-reads on EAN labels, so gate both artifacts in the same release train. Smoke test: scan the reference sheet at the packing bench and confirm all twelve codes resolve. If the decode service account locks after a failed rollout, the unlock console will ask for the recovery passphrase shown below.

unlock words, bagug-bafop: julwyn-belox-kasvan-zorath-tamax-praiel